FEATURED ARTIST FOR 2012

GARRY PETTITT

Garry Pettitt - Clearing mist Wolgan Valley

Garry Pettitt - A life on the land

Garry has been entering  the Portland Art  Exhibition since 1989 and has sold many of his art works.

His "Govetts Leap Vista" won the President's Award for "Best Landscape in Traditional Style" at the 2011 Sydney Royal Easter Show.

"A  Life on the land" (portrait of local identity Chris Bird) won First Prize in figurative, Best Exhibit across sections 1-22 and an Award of Excellence at the 2011 Sydney Royal Easter Show.


Garry was born in Lithgow, NSW, Australia in 1959. He was educated at Lithgow Primary and Lithgow High schools. He began painting at the age of 10 and is self-taught. Garry became a qualified electrician after leaving school. After an absence from painting for around 10 years, he started again in 1989. He finished as an electrician in 1994 to pursue a career in art.

Garry Pettitt - Whispered_words

Since turning professional, his career success has escalated, winning many awards, including Most Outstanding Traditional Landscape in the Sydney Royal Easter Show 2008, People's Choice Portland 2010, and Most Outstanding Traditional Landscape, 1st Figurative, Best Exhibit Art Classes 1-22, and Award of Excellence at Sydney Royal Easter Show 2011.

He has held 5 major solo exhibitions, all of which have been a huge success. He has featured in Australian Artist magazine, and is well on his way to reaching his goal of achieving high status amongst the best traditional artists in Australia.

For some years, Garry has struggled between owner-building and his paintings, working on a house in South Bowenfels that will eventually hold a gallery. In his "spare" time he continues to produce works. He hopes to finish the house in the next 5 years.

Garry currently resides in South Bowenfels, near Lithgow, in the Blue Mountains, NSW, Australia.

Portland Art Purchase Society

The Portland Art Purchase Society welcomes you.

The Portland Art Society Inc. hold an art exhibition every year the first weekend in March and have done so since 1976.

In 2011 the 35th exhibition was held and an outstanding range of paintings were sold. The exhibition, which is highly rated in NSW allows a great diversification of artists to present and show their work. More information is available in the About Us page.

The Roaring 20s...and all that Jazz! Festival
, now in its second year, is a month long programme of events held across the Blue Mountains, Lithgow and Oberon, that pays tribute to the 1920s era when the region was revelling in a halcyon time.

February will be full of events including vintage fashion parades, period costume walks and adventure experiences, costume balls, high teas, steam and vintage vehicle displays, jazz performances and The Charleston Challenge Downunder, a world record attempt in Leura Mall to gather the largest ever number of costumed dancers stepping out the Charleston.
